Participants walk in their MLLs’ shoes by first experiencing the frustration and disengagement that comes with not understanding a traditional lesson taught in a foreign language. A second version of the same lesson demonstrates the power of effective scaffolding in making content and language accessible. The strategies used are then identified, discussed, and unpacked.
By attending this session, attendees will leave with…
– Experience with and debriefing on 8 high leverage strategies for making MLL curriculum and instruction more accessible for Multilingual Learners (MLLs). In the second part of this session, participants will go more deeply into one of the core strategies–Building Schema for MLLs. Participants will work on applying this new learning to their own curriculum
